Chinese mobile phone manufacturer, Huawei will soon be launching its Ascend Y200 and Y300 this month for the Indian market. The new smartphones are an addition to its popular Ascend series which are based on the Android Operating system.

The Ascend Y200s based on Android 2.3 operating system and comes with 800Mhz Qualcomm MSM7225A Snapdragon Cortex A5 processor. The device also features Adreno 200 graphics processing unit with 256 B RAM.

The other features of the phone include3.15 ,mega pixel primary camera, 3.5 inch touch screen with connectivity features like Wi-Fi, Bluetooth , micro USB port, a memory slot which can be expandable up to 32 GB, About the pricing it is expected to be price at Rs. 10,000.While the Huawei Y300 is bigger than the Y200.

The device has been powered by Android 2.3 operating system with a 1 GHz processor and 512 MB RAM. The other features of the phone include, 4 inch display and a 5 mega pixel camera with auto focus. The connectivity features of the phone include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and micro USB port. The official pricing of the phones are yet to be revealed by the company.
